Pavers Landscaping in Fairfield County, CT
Pavers landscaping services involve installing, repairing, and maintaining paved surfaces such as walkways, patios, driveways, and outdoor seating areas. These projects typically utilize materials like concrete, brick, or stone pavers to create durable and visually appealing surfaces that enhance outdoor living spaces. Homeowners interested in pavers often seek to improve the functionality and aesthetic of their yards, whether by creating a welcoming patio area or a practical driveway that withstands daily use.
Before requesting pavers landscaping services, property owners should consider factors such as the intended use of the space, the type of materials that best suit their style and climate, and the overall design they envision. It’s helpful to understand the scope of the project, including the size of the area to be paved, drainage considerations, and any necessary preparation work. Clear communication of these details can ensure the outcome aligns with expectations and complements the property's existing landscape.
